Abstract
The utility model provides a bed cabinet drawer based on sensor just is used for illumination at night to use belongs to the drawer field. The multifunctional bed cabinet comprises a bed cabinet body, wherein a drawer is movably connected in the bed cabinet body, a light sensation sensor capable of analyzing illumination intensity is arranged on the drawer, the light sensation sensor is connected with a light source power supply, the light source power supply is further connected with an infrared sensor and a drawer front lamp, and two drawer inner lamps connected with the light source power supply are further arranged in the drawer. The utility model discloses the advantage lies in according to the switch of the signal control light source power that infrared sensor produced, infrared sensor can feel in one's hands and be close to and make drawer headlight and drawer interior lamp luminous, need not open under the condition of room lamp night to and the convenient people uses when the drawer wakes up and turns in the middle of the night.

Background
In the existing design of indoor articles, bedside cabinets are usually placed on two sides of a bed, drawers are arranged in the bedside cabinets, a user can place some articles necessary for life in the drawers, generally, when the user needs to open the drawers after waking up in the middle of the night, the user needs to open the indoor lamps to find the positions of drawer handles, draw out the drawers and illuminate the space in the drawers so as to take the articles required, but in the process, certain time needs to be consumed on one hand, on the other hand, the process is complicated, therefore, the user is very inconvenient, and in the process of turning on the lamps in the dark, the articles placed on the bedside cabinets are very easy to overturn, and therefore, the bed cabinet drawers used for night illumination need to be designed.
For example, chinese patent document discloses a novel LED drawer lamp [ patent application No.: CN201120020910.8], an LED lamp, a sensor for detecting the state of the drawer, and a lampshade for protecting the LED lamp are disposed on the lamp body, and a battery for supplying power to the LED lamp is disposed in the lamp body. The LED lamp is in plurality. The LED lamp and the lampshade are arranged on the upper surface sensor of the lamp body, and the sensor is arranged on the side surface of the lamp body. The sensor is a reflective photoelectric sensor. This novel LED drawer lamp can provide illumination when the drawer is opened automatically, and the daily life of giving people brings the facility. However, the drawer is only provided with the lamp arranged in the drawer, when the drawer needs to be opened after waking up in the middle of the night, the drawer can be pulled out by finding the position of the drawer handle by opening the indoor lamp, in the process, certain time needs to be consumed, and in the process, the process is complicated, so that the drawer is very inconvenient, and articles placed on the bedside table are very easy to overturn when the user turns on the lamp in the dark.

Detailed Description
The present invention will be described in further detail with reference to the accompanying drawings and specific embodiments.
Referring to fig. 1-4, a bed cabinet drawer based on sensors and used for night illumination comprises a bed cabinet 10, the bed cabinet 10 is internally and movably connected with a drawer 11, the drawer 11 is provided with a light sensation sensor 12 capable of analyzing illumination intensity, the light sensation sensor 12 is connected with a light source power supply 13, the light source power supply 13 is further connected with an infrared sensor 14 and a drawer front lamp 15, and the drawer 11 is internally provided with two drawer inner lamps 16 connected with the light source power supply 13.
The light sensor 12 can receive external light, when the external light is sufficient, the light sensor 12 generates a pulse modulation signal to the light source power supply 13, at the moment, the light source power supply 13 stops working, so that the drawer front lamp 15 and the drawer inner lamp 16 are prevented from working to illuminate the drawer 11, because the external illumination intensity is enough to illuminate the drawer 11 at the moment, when the light is insufficient at night, the light sensor 12 generates a pulse modulation signal to the light source power supply 13, the light source power supply 13 at the moment can be switched on, and the switch of the light source power supply 13 is controlled according to a signal generated by the infrared sensor 14, at the moment, when a hand approaches the drawer 11, the infrared sensor 14 can sense the approach of the hand and generate a signal to the light source power supply 13, at the moment, the light source power supply 13 works to enable the drawer front lamp 15 and the drawer inner lamp 16 to emit light, and the drawer front lamp 15 emits light to, the drawer 11 can be accurately pulled out, the light 16 in the drawer can illuminate the space in the drawer 11, and the drawer 11 can be conveniently turned when the user needs not to turn on the indoor light at night and wakes up at midnight.
At night or when light is not enough, when the drawer 11 is not taken out, the shifting piece 20 is clamped between the first connecting line 17 and the second connecting line 18, the first connecting line 17 and the second connecting line 18 are disconnected, when a hand is close to the drawer 11, the infrared sensor 14 can sense the approach of the hand and generate a signal to the light source power supply 13, the light source power supply 13 works to enable the drawer front lamp 15 to emit light at the moment, because the shifting piece 20 is clamped between the first connecting line 17 and the second connecting line 18, the drawer inner lamp 16 does not emit light at the moment, when a person is at night, the drawer front lamp 15 can be used as a night lamp and can save energy until the drawer 11 is taken out, the shifting piece 20 extends out between the first connecting line 17 and the second connecting line 18, so that the first connecting line 17 is communicated with the second connecting line 18, the drawer inner lamp 16 emits light, namely, when the drawer 11 is opened, the drawer inner lamp 16 emits light.

In this example, when the drawer 11 is closed, the shifting piece 20 is not in contact with the connecting block 21, the first connecting line 17 penetrates through and is connected with the second connecting line 18 through the connecting block 21, and when the drawer 11 is closed, the shifting piece 20 abuts against the connecting block 21 and pushes the connecting block 21 away from the second connecting line 18, so that the first connecting line 17 is disconnected from the second connecting line 18.
Each connecting block 21 is provided with an extending block 22, and a spring 23 which can enable the extending block 22 to be close to the second connecting line 18 is further arranged between the extending block 22 and the drawer 11.
In this example, when the pusher 20 is not in contact with the connecting block 21, the spring 23 is used to make the extension block 22 close to the second connecting line 18, so that the connecting block 21 is close to the second connecting line 18, and the first connecting line 17 is tightly connected with the second connecting line 18, and when the pusher 20 pushes the connecting block 21 against the connecting block 21 and works against the spring 23.
The drawer 11 is provided with a handle 24, and the drawer front lamp 15 is arranged on the handle 24.
The position where the drawer front light 15 is lighted is the position of the handle 24, and when the drawer front light is used, only the position where the light is lighted needs to be paid attention to, and the position of the handle 24 does not need to be specially found.
Two sides of the drawer 11 are respectively provided with a guide groove 25, and a guide block 26 arranged on the bed cabinet 10 is movably connected in each guide groove 25.
The guide groove 25 has guiding and limiting functions, on one hand, the movement of the drawer 11 is facilitated, on the other hand, the movement of the drawer 11 is stabilized, the drawer 11 is prevented from being inclined and deviated, and the shifting piece 20 can be accurately moved between the first connecting line 17 and the second connecting line 18.
Two sides of the tail of the drawer 11 are respectively provided with a limiting block 27, and the two guide blocks 26 can respectively extend into the two limiting blocks 27.
When the drawer 11 is drawn out and moved to the bottom end, the two guide blocks 26 extend into the two limiting blocks 27 respectively, so as to prevent the drawer 11 from being drawn out continuously.
Preferably, the light source power supply 13 includes a power supply slot 28 disposed at the head of the drawer 11 for accommodating a battery.
Because the bed cabinet 10 is located the side of bed and moves often, compare in switching on the power through the electric wire plug, it is more convenient to adopt the mode of battery electricity-taking.
The infrared sensor 14 is positioned above the handle 24.
When the hand is moved down close to the drawer 11, the infrared sensor 14 is triggered and the drawer front light 15 on the handle 24 is lighted without moving to the handle 24 position.
